Instructions

  1. Step 1: Rinse and soak 1 cup dried black beans in cold water for 6 hours or overnight, then drain.
  2. Step 2: Heat 2 tbsp ol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add 8 oz sliced smoked sausage and sauté for 4-5 minutes until browned and fragrant.
  3. Step 3: Add 1 diced medium onion, 1 diced red bell pepper, 1 diced large carrot, and 3 minced garlic cloves to the pot. Cook, stirring occasionally, for 6-7 minutes until the vegetables soften and the garlic is fragrant.
  4. Step 4: Stir in 1 tsp cumin powder, 1 tsp smoked paprika, and 1 bay leaf, cooking for 1 minute to toast the spices.
  5. Step 5: Add the soaked black beans and 4 cups vegetable broth.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low and simmer uncovered for 1 to 1.5 hours, stirring occasionally, until beans are tender and stew thickens.
  6. Step 6: Season with salt and black pepper to taste. Remove the bay leaf. Garnish with 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ro and serve with rice or crusty bread.

How do I store leftover Brazilian-Style Black Bean Stew with Sausage and Vegetables?

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ep dried black beans from drying out.
